7 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Squander'

The careless teenager continued to squander his time playing video games instead of focusing on his studies.

Rather than saving for the future, she chose to squander her salary on trendy fashion items and expensive gadgets.

The athlete regretted his decision to squander his talent by neglecting his training and indulging in unhealthy habits.

The team's coach was frustrated with their tendency to squander scoring opportunities during crucial matches.

Despite knowing the importance of saving, he continued to squander his monthly allowance on unnecessary gadgets.

The extravagant lifestyle of the heiress led her to squander her inheritance in a short span of time.

The artist refused to squander her creativity on mundane projects, choosing only those that truly inspired her.
